It is not a question of how badly we want to win the world cup. Its more a question of when will we have the right kind of depth in both bowling and batting for us to win a Worldcup. If desire and passion could win cricket games then we, the fans of BC would have all become international cricketers. What differentiates our boys and a good cricket side is the skill levels, temparment as well as understanding of the game.
Sri Lanka has already shown us what we need to do in order rise from being a minnow into a worldcup champion. If you look at their 96 squad... they had a great leader, who was also a fantastic middle order player, they had Arvinda who was one of the best no. 3 batters around one that could play both pace and spin equally well, they had Jaysuria and Kalu who were limited in technique but highly effective in attacking the new ball during field restrictions, they had a varied spin attack and swing bowlers who did a good enough holding job.
If you compare that side with our current side now... our middle order is non existant. We don't have a single world class batter in the middle order. Our opening combination is simply okay but does not pack enough punch to upset teams on their own. Our bowling attack is severely one dimentional. So out of 11 slots needed to build a worldcup winning side we probably can fill only two positions with Shakib and Tamim.

Of course I want the WC to be ours. I believe that by next WC, our boys will be a lot better. We still have to be more consistent then we are now. Key is to win more series against the G8. If we can do that then we can become a good ODI side. Between 07-11, we just won 1 series against a G8 team. That's just not good enough if you want to win a WC. We had some wins here and there but we just haven't been consistent enough.
The core we have now is pretty promising. We finally have an opening pair in Tamim and Imrul, a good #3 in SN, and a world class allrounder in Shakib at #5. In our batting order, we still need a #4. I thought not figuring who was gonna be our #4 for this past WC really hurt us bad. Rokibul wasn't the answer and we kept on trying him and then in the WC we tried Mushy who was no better. We should've figured that out long ago. I believe Shakib's the right man for the job since he's our best at rotating the strike. And then our bowling is pretty promising as well. Shafiul looks like he can be a world class bowler and played big parts in wins. Rubel also has big potential. We got Shakib of course. So I'm optimistic for the next 1. We just have to plan it well.
